Metal Detectors Safe for Heart Patients While airport metal detectors are safe for people with pacemakers and implantable cardioverter defibrillators (ICDs), the abdominal stimulator belts advertised on TV to tone muscles can interfere with the sophisticated medical devices, according to two recent studies. Eat Well and Lower Your Blood Pressure The winning combination to dramatically lower blood pressure includes weight loss, exercise, reduced salt intake, and a healthy diet, according to a national study called PREMIER, conducted at Johns Hopkins and three other leading institutions.
